A printed circuit card is a detailed structure made by layering conductive paths onto a shielding substrate. These pathways are crucial for attaching different electronic components, such as resistors, capacitors, and microcontrollers, making PCBs critical for device performance. When designing PCBs, manufacturers should take into consideration aspects like trace width and current, impedance control, and a variety of variables that add to the total performance of the electronic circuit card. Parametric factors to consider such as the dimension of the PCB, the density of interconnections, and the materials made use of can considerably affect both functionality and manufacturability.
With advancements in technology, the change in the direction of high-density interconnect (HDI) PCBs has actually acquired traction, allowing for smaller sized, extra effective tools that can effectively handle increasing information lots. On the other hand, flexible printed circuits (FPCs) have arised as a game-changer, supplying bendable remedies that adapt to different shapes and dimensions.
The manufacturing of flexible PCBs needs different strategies contrasted to conventional rigid boards, including specialized products that can endure duplicated bending without losing connection. Making use of polyimide and other flexible substratums is crucial in making certain durability and long life. As understanding of PCB manufacturing expands, essential considerations need to likewise consist of the different aspects of design, such as microvias and fiducials. Fiducial marks enhance the precision of component positioning throughout assembly, while microvias enable for more detailed connections in HDI boards, making it possible for tighter spacing between traces. Buried and blind vias can further boost circuit density, offering chances for advanced circuit designs that press the boundaries of typical PCB layouts.
In instances where power supply stability is vital, heavy copper PCBs have gotten recognition as a robust solution. These boards feature thicker copper layers to manage high current tons, making them excellent for applications in power electronics, such as power supply boards and industrial circuits. The application of metal core products, such as aluminum or ceramic substratums, click here in specific PCB designs additionally aids in thermal administration, ensuring that heat is dissipated efficiently, therefore lengthening component life and enhancing dependability.
